Amsterdam Lions Lacrosse has four teams – 1 men’s, 2 women’s and 1 youth – and is represented in the first, second, and third divisions of the national competition. Experience with the game is by no means necessary to become a member and join the club! Practices are twice a week, on Tuesdays and on Fridays at Sportpark Middenmeer.
Besides practicing hard to improve our game, there’s also a big social side to being a Lion. Post-practice-borrels, boat parties, dinner parties, BBQ’s – you name it. There’s a reason that the proverb states: ‘there’s no “I” in Lions’!
